NZUSA Tie
NZUSA awarded itself what Vice-President Keren Clark called a "more exclusive" club tie at Council.
The tie will be available to officers of the Executive, to overseas delegates from NZUSA and to the presidents of the Associations.
Members calculated that the minimum order of 10¼ dozen ties meant a 12-year supply would have to be stocked. "To spread it any further is to cheapen the value of the tie," said Victoria president Moriarty.
Also among what Armour Mitchell called NZUSA's "self-awarded souvenirs" was a "non-expensive" lapel badge for overseas representatives.
